Choose the correct alternative that expresses the 'Future Perfect' tense:
Verified Answer
A. She will be completing her assignment
B. She will complete her assignment
C. She is completing her assignment
D. She will have completed her assignment by midnight
Explanation:
The Future Perfect tense is used to describe an action that will be completed before a specific point in the future. Its structure is 'will have + past participle (V3)'. Option (4) 'She will have completed her assignment by midnight' correctly uses this structure and indicates an action (completing the assignment) that will be finished by a future deadline (by midnight).
